UGOCHUKWU ANTHONY OGAKWU, J.C.A.(Delivering the Leading Judgment): This appeal is against the decision of the High Court of Lagos State, Coram Justice: D. O. Oluwayemi, J. in SUIT NO. M/166/2011: REV. ZEBULON HARRISON IKUEGBOWO and ORS. v. INSPECTOR GENERAL OF POLICE and ORS. By an Originating Motion on Notice filed on 12th November, 2012, the Respondents herein, who were the Applicants at the lower Court, applied for the enforcement of the fundamental rights, claiming the following reliefs:

A. A DECLARATION that the arrest of the Applicants in October, 2010 and January 2011 by the respondents, their agents, servants, officers or otherwise howsoever at Itedo, Lekki, Lagos State constitutes a flagrant violation of the Applicants fundamental rights guaranteed under Sections 35, 38, 40 and 41 of the Constitution of the Federal Republic of Nigeria, 1999 and Articles 4, 5, 6, 9, 12 and 14 of the African Charter on Human and Peoples Rights (Ratification and Enforcement) Act Cap. 10, Laws of …
